SCHO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2023 in Review

581 of the 6,369 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Schwab Short-Term US Treasury ETF (SCHO) for Q2 2023, worth a combined $11.8B — up 12% from $10.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 70 funds opened new SCHO positions and 56 closed out — a net gain of 14 holders — while 224 added to existing stakes and 212 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$1.15B. The largest seller was Edgehill Endowment Partners, exiting entirely with an estimated $61.4M sold.
